Hst Proposal Id #9542 Stellar Populations

Scientific paper

The central surface brightness and luminosity density profiles in any stellar system are crucial for understanding the governing dynamical processes. Those profiles for galaxies are well-measured by HST and have been used to make significant scientific progress. Globular clusters, on the other hand, do not have a well established dataset for their central surface brightness profiles. Yet, the archive is ripe with high signal-to-noise data on globular clusters. We will measure the central surface brightness profiles for about 30 globular clusters. We have searched the archives for those clusters with adequate signal to provide robust estimates of their central profile. This data will be combined with our extensive radial velocity dataset in the central regions to provide a unique opportunity to explore the central dynamics. The radial velocities show a dramatic increase in the rotational signature at small radii. Interpretation of this result requires a detailed understanding of the central surface brightness profiles. Any future endeavor to study globular cluster dynamics must include the central profiles. We have reached the point where the kinematics have been analysed to better spatial resolution, and this proposal addresses the need to place the surface brightness profiles on a more firm level.
